Description
Ethmoidal labyrinth dominates this superior view, with the paired lateral masses flanking the midline where the cribriform plate would sit to support the olfactory bulbs. Multiple ethmoidal air cells form a gridlike honeycomb across the roof of the labyrinth, separated by thin bony septa that create a repeating rectangular pattern. Anteriorly, the labyrinth narrows and tapers, while laterally the paper-thin lamina papyracea forms the medial orbital wall and defines the outer boundary of the ethmoidal complex. Fine cortical margins and internal trabeculation make the paranasal sinus architecture legible at a glance. Ethmoid anatomy is unforgiving in endoscopic sinus surgery, where a few millimeters separate the ethmoidal air cells from the orbit and anterior cranial fossa. Breach of the lamina papyracea can lead to orbital emphysema, medial rectus injury, or postoperative diplopia, while violation of the fovea ethmoidalis or cribriform region raises the stakes for cerebrospinal fluid leak and meningitis. The fixed superior perspective supports teaching of the ethmoidal lateral masses as a three-dimensional bony labyrinth, and the even lighting helps readers distinguish true septations from the outer cortical shell, a common point of confusion when correlating with coronal CT of the ethmoid sinuses.
